Bioaugmentation for enhancing biological wastewater treatment
Biotechnology Advances, 1992The literature on bioaugmentation products has been reviewed. Their manufacture and method of use is explained. The various applications are listed and the independent investigations, as opposed to manufacturers accounts, at laboratory and full scale are reviewed. The economics and kinetic modelling are also discussed.

Bioaugmentation of oil-contaminated soils
АгроЭкоИнфо, 2023In a field experiment, the high efficiency of the in situ bioaugmentation method was demonstrated using three biological products (Putidoil, Arkoil and Multibak Asset) to clean up the territory in the Volgograd region 6 years after an emergency oil spill.
